Location Overview : For more than 50 years, the nonprofit Brooks Rehabilitation, headquartered in Jacksonville, Fla., has been a comprehensive system of care for physical rehabilitation.
Ranked as the No. 1 rehabilitation hospital in Florida and one of the top 20 in the nation on U.S. News & World Report, Brooks operates two inpatient rehabilitation hospitals in Jacksonville, Fla.
- and a Center for Inpatient Rehabilitation in partnership with Halifax Health (Daytona Beach). Brooks also offers one of the region’s largest home healthcare agencies;
- more than 50 outpatient therapy clinics; the Brooks Rehabilitation Medical Group; two skilled nursing facilities; assisted living;
memory care; and the Clinical Research Center, which specializes in advanced research to further the science of rehabilitation.
In addition, Brooks provides many low- or no-cost community programs and services to improve the quality of life for people living with physical disabilities.

Position Summary : Responsible for the management, development and oversight of the Respiratory Program in a 170-bed acute rehabilitation hospital.
Persons served include adults and pediatric patients with Traumatic Brain Injury, Spinal Cord, Stroke, Medically Complex, Orthopedic injuries, and Respiratory conditions requiring mechanical ventilation.
Job Responsibilities :
- Ensures that all staff levels (RT) function appropriately within the guidelines of the National Board of Respiratory Care and other practice acts as applicable.
- Provides direction and supervision for Respiratory Care Practitioners.
- Delivers direct patient care as necessary.
- Interviews, selects and manages performance for Respiratory personnel.
- Demonstrates awareness of budget parameters and meets hospital guidelines with cost.
- Is knowledgeable of TJC standards, CMS regulations, National Board of Respiratory Care and ensures standards are implemented in department.
- Develops program processes around Rehabilitation specialty certifications such as Magnet, CARF, and Brain and Spinal Cord Injury certification, laboratory (CAP) surveys and accreditation.
- Develops program structures that support the interdisciplinary approach to patient care and address the special needs of Rehabilitation patients.
- Coordinates education of all direct care clinicians around respiratory care, policies and protocols.
